The Brass Kings

Washboard Rope Guitar

2008-05-26

This Minneapolis trio features a simple lineup and an energetic show that will appeal to fans of the Tarbox Ramblers, Mulebone, and Devil in a Woodpile. Percussive instruments include a washboard, a rope, tambourine, fridge door and hand drum. The sound is rounded out with washtub bass and acoustic and resonator guitars. –Pete
